Senna pre-release screening with director Asif Kapadia

By special arrangement with F1 in America and The San Francisco Formula 1 Group, ‘SENNA’ will be shown Thursday, August 18th, ahead of general release in the San Francisco Bay Area.

Director Asif Kapadia has graciously arranged to make time to attend this special San Francisco screening to discuss the film for a truly one-of-a-kind evening with you – all interested in the film and it’s legendary subject are welcome to attend.

Over 15,000 hours of archive footage were considered by Kapadia for a work of film that critics, F1 fans, non-race fans and especially the Senna family love. The film has been moving moviegoers around the world since it opened last October, and hit the ground running in the United States earlier this year taking the 2011 World Cinema Documentary Audience Award at Sundance.

100th Anniversary of Juan Manuel Fangio

Celebrate the 100th anniversary of the birth of Juan Manuel Fangio by watching this amazing 6-lap race between him and Sir Jack Brabham from 1978 Australian Grand Prix. Fangio is 66 years old and is racing his title winning W196 Mercedes Benz against Brabham in his title winning Repco Brabham. The two of them have an incredible 8 world championships between them.

Special LOG 31 registration rates for GGLC members

The largest gathering of Lotus enthusiasts in 2011 will take place at Lotus Owners Gathering 31 in Las Vegas. LOG 31 will be hosted by the Southern Nevada Lotus Car Club and Lotus Ltd with the GGLC has sub-host.

Over 400 Lotus enthusiasts are expected from across the country and around the world.

What is LOG? Think West Coast Lotus Meet on steroids, bigger, more events, more fun! There will be karting, bowling, concours, autocrossing, track day, scenic tours, tech sessions, Lotus contests and more!
